Retail Fixture Rollouts: Same Kit, Twenty Stores, One Window
How multi-store retail fixture rollouts work: kitting by store, sequencing vehicles across the window, dedicated trucks and per-store proof of delivery.

A fixture rollout is a strange piece of freight: the shipment is simple, but the project isn’t. Every store gets roughly the same kit — gondolas, shelving, display tables, signage, sometimes point-of-sale hardware — and every store has to get it inside the same short window, because the campaign or refresh goes live network-wide on one date. One truck, one store, one delivery is easy. Twenty stores in five days across the GTA is a coordination problem wearing a freight costume.
The good news: rollouts are a solved problem. The method below is how fixture manufacturers, display houses and brand teams run them — kit by store, sequence the vehicles, and close every location with paper.
A rollout is one project, not twenty shipments
The core mental shift: stop thinking in deliveries and start thinking in stores completed. Booking twenty separate one-off shipments with twenty separate confirmations is how rollouts fall apart — each delivery is individually fine, and collectively nobody can answer “how many stores are done and which one is next?”
Run as a single project, the rollout has one manifest (every store, every kit, every window), one coordinator on the carrier side who sees the whole board, and one thread of communication. When a store’s receiving situation changes or an install crew falls behind, the sequence adjusts in one place instead of across twenty booking references. This is the same discipline used for IT hardware deployments — many stores, one program — and the freight side of it looks nearly identical.
Kit and label by store before anything moves
The rollout is won or lost at the staging warehouse. Before the first truck loads:
- One kit per store, palletized together, containing everything that location needs — fixtures, hardware packs, signage, install accessories. A store kit that’s short one box of brackets stalls an entire install crew.
- Label by store number, large and on every pallet: store number, address, kit count (“Pallet 2 of 3”). Not just a packing slip in a pouch — visible from across a truck deck.
- Verify counts at staging, not at the store. Discovering a shortage in a stockroom two hours before install is too late to fix cheaply.
- Keep signage with its store. Store-specific graphics and dimensional signage are the easiest things to cross-ship between locations, and the hardest to swap back. Sign packages have their own handling quirks — our guide to shipping signage and displays covers them.
When the kits are clean, the freight is boring — which is exactly what you want.
One more staging-stage habit that pays for itself: deliver the first store as a pilot. Run store one a day or two ahead of the main wave, with someone from the program on site. Every weakness in the kit — a missing hardware pack, a label that confused the receiver, an assembly that should have shipped flat — shows up at store one, where it’s fixable, instead of at stores two through twenty simultaneously, where it isn’t.
Two ways to run the window
With kits staged, the delivery plan comes down to sequencing. There are two basic models, and most real rollouts blend them:
| Model | How it works | Best when |
|---|---|---|
| Sequential | One vehicle loads several store kits and delivers them in route order, day after day, until the list is done | The window is wider, stores are geographically clustered, install crews move store-to-store behind the truck |
| Parallel | Multiple vehicles run different territories in the same window — one covers the west GTA, another the east, another Hamilton–Niagara | The window is tight, the network is spread across Southern Ontario, several install crews work simultaneously |
Sequential is efficient and easy to track; parallel buys speed when the go-live date compresses everything. The blend — two or three vehicles, each running a sequential route through its own territory — is how a twenty-store network across Toronto, Mississauga, Hamilton and Kitchener–Waterloo gets done inside one window without heroics.
Why dedicated vehicles fit rollout work
Rollouts favour dedicated vehicles — a truck and driver assigned to your project rather than your freight sharing space with whatever else is moving that day. Three reasons:
- The schedule belongs to the project. Store delivery windows, install-crew timing and mall receiving rules drive the route — not another shipper’s stops.
- The same driver learns the network. By store five, the driver knows what your kits look like, how your labels read and what the install lead needs. That familiarity compounds across the rollout.
- Multi-stop is the whole point. A dedicated truck loaded with four store kits delivering in sequence is the natural unit of rollout work; it doesn’t fit neatly into single-shipment freight products.
Vehicle size follows the kit: a store’s worth of flat-packed fixtures often fits a Sprinter or a few pallet positions in a box truck; assembled gondolas and large display tables want the full 26-foot box.
Receiving at retail: the ground truth
Retail receiving is wildly inconsistent, and the manifest should capture each store’s reality before the window opens: mall dock with a booking system, or street-front door? Receiving hours set by the landlord? Fixtures going to the stockroom, or straight to the floor because there is no stockroom? Any location with no dock needs a tailgate-equipped truck flagged in advance.
Off-hours installs are common in retail — crews often work after close so the store trades normally through the refresh. Delivery timing follows whatever the store, landlord and install schedule allow; the key is that those windows are confirmed per store at booking, not negotiated at the door.
Don’t forget the freight moving the other way. Most refreshes displace old fixtures, and the empty truck that just delivered a kit is the natural vehicle to backhaul the outgoing gondolas to a warehouse, a recycler or the next store on the reuse list. Building the reverse leg into the same stops costs little; sending trucks back for it later costs a second rollout.
Close every store with a POD
Each store delivery closes with a signed proof of delivery: who received the kit, when, and the piece count. Across a rollout this becomes the project’s scoreboard — at any moment, the coordinator can say which stores are complete, which are scheduled, and which flexed to later slots, with paper behind every “done.” When the brand team asks on Thursday how the network looks for Monday’s launch, that answer comes from the POD trail, not from memory.

Frequently asked questions
How far ahead should a fixture rollout be booked?
As soon as the store list and window are known — lead time varies with the number of locations and how tightly the window is compressed, but the constraint is rarely the driving. It's the upstream work: kitting and labelling by store, confirming each location's receiving situation, and lining up vehicles for the same window. The earlier that starts, the fewer surprises mid-rollout.
What happens if one store isn't ready for its delivery?
The rollout doesn't stop — the sequence flexes. The affected store's kit stays on the vehicle or returns to staging, the run continues to the next location, and the missed store is rescheduled into a later slot in the window. This is why a little slack in the schedule and a single coordinator with the full picture matter.
Do retail fixtures ship assembled or flat?
Both, and the kit list should say which. Flat-packed fixtures cube efficiently and ride palletized; pre-assembled units save install time but eat truck space and need more protection. Many rollouts mix the two — flat-pack for volume pieces, assembled for anything complex or fragile.
